diff options
| author | Bobby <[email protected]> | 2026-02-06 18:26:15 +0530 |
|---|---|---|
| committer | Bobby <[email protected]> | 2026-02-06 18:26:15 +0530 |
| commit | 185d84e2dbe18dca60592bb33f491c5cd3d09403 (patch) | |
| tree | 49ef4e02b9e83bce48610c0a44a457927bdc78c5 /repositories/genre.go | |
| parent | 31b5543be4faa4f01946d532d4b5e34828b285b5 (diff) | |
| download | metachan-185d84e2dbe18dca60592bb33f491c5cd3d09403.tar.xz metachan-185d84e2dbe18dca60592bb33f491c5cd3d09403.zip | |
Refactor database interactions: replace direct database calls with DB variable and implement batch creation for images and producers
Diffstat (limited to 'repositories/genre.go')
| -rw-r--r-- | repositories/genre.go |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/repositories/genre.go b/repositories/genre.go index ed27db4..0d95f66 100644 --- a/repositories/genre.go +++ b/repositories/genre.go @@ -2,7 +2,6 @@ package repositories import ( "errors" - "metachan/database" "metachan/entities" "metachan/utils/logger" @@ -10,7 +9,7 @@ import ( ) func CreateOrUpdateGenre(genre *entities.Genre) error { - result := database.DB.Clauses(clause.OnConflict{ + result := DB.Clauses(clause.OnConflict{ Columns: []clause.Column{{Name: "genre_id"}}, DoUpdates: clause.AssignmentColumns([]string{"name", "url", "count"}), }).Create(genre) |
